BY: JEN KASSEBART
Michael and Mena Mandara are bringing their New York-style pizza, slow-cooked sauces, old family recipes, classic Italian favorites, specialty cocktails and wines to their newest family-friendly restaurant, Mandara Ristorante, Bar & Pizzeria, now located at 40 Clinton Road in West Caldwell. Mena said she and her husband came upon the West Caldwell area through a good friend and felt it would be the perfect location for their newest restaurant.
A few weeks after the restaurant's official opening, diners Alan Schindler and Christy Berg said they enjoy eating at Mandara Ristorante because the "service is lovely" and that everything they have tasted is delicious, including options off the wine list. The Caldwell residents also said they were thrilled to have a new place nearby with a nice atmosphere where they can enjoy a peaceful dinner along with a glass of wine or a cocktail.
